Is there a download for a worldwide league?

Hey, i think i have the basics of the game down. Talk about a great idea! I am looking to create a league that is something of a snapshot (i was thinking right after the World Baseball Classic) that incorporates not only the MLB players, but all their minors, as well as leagues in other nations that run simultaneously throughout the year. THat way, when i send a scout to Japan, i am actually seeing the Matsuzakes of the league and not jsut searching for a random player with a Japanese name. This was probably getting out of hand, but i even wanted the U.S. college teams. I have been accused of being a completist before, but this is really what i wanted this game to do when i first got it.

I figured it would be a chore, so i wanted to snoop around and see if it had been attempted by any on this great community first.

That sounds pretty ambitious; I have not heard of a roster set that includes real players from foreign leagues. You may want to scan our Mods forum yourself, or PadreFan's mod web site: Templates

But your best bet may be to use a Cubby's roster, or the one that comes with OOTP 8 (that one does include real minor league players; I'm not sure about whether the modders do the same), then add some foreign leagues yourself and do some editing to have some Matsuzakas in the game.
